Harmony Wood Burning Stoves

The Harmony wood burning stove range has an unprecedented history. Designed in the early 1980`s its progression to todays high efficiency, clean burning user friendly appliance is the result of over 150 years of combined stove experience.

The Harmony wood burning stove has at its heart an accurate air distribution and control system; the plexus control. This offers the user simple and precise fire regulation for lighting, heating, overnight burning, clean glass and the ability for use in smokeless zones, and the ability to switch between wood burning and coal burning by simply flicking a switch.

The Harmony wood stove might look traditional but under the reassuring cast iron exterior is a piece of pure contemporary engineering.

The use of cast iron for the external design and internal combustion chamber is known as the perfect stove material. However to obtain air tight combustion the layer between internal and external cast iron is constructed of a high quality steel envelope.

Plexus Control

A single lever air flow selector provides the correct air flow direction for different fuels. Air volume is controlled by rotaing cams, giving precise control of the stove's burning rate. A minium burning rate shutter can be adjusted to suit the performance of the flue and ensures safe burning at all times.

ZR Air Distribution

The ZR air delivery system delivers its pre-heated air throughout the combustion chamber as a gentle breeze rather than a curtain of air. This means the volatile components of the fuel are burned as a priority, before any unused air is available to cause the fire to generate more volatile components; this ensures clean, complete combustion.

Double Glazed Door

The double glazed door adds extra security, togther with increased resistance to tar deposits. When a mistake is made whilst using the stove and the glass becomes dirty, just increase the fire's temperature and the glass burns clean.

Approvals and Certifications

The Harmony wood stove range conforms and excels to new UK and European testing standards CE13240. Part of this standard, tests and reports the efficiency of the stove; the Harmony range are among the highest results ever recorded.

Approved for Use In Smokeless Zones

Around 80% of the UK population live in what are referred to as smoke exempt areas. This means only stoves which have passed the very strict smoke control testing can burn wood in these area`s. The Harmony range has not only passed the requirements but has set new standards by achieving some of the cleanest combustion ever recorded for a stove. That's not all, the Harmony 23 is the only stove tested for overnight burning as a continous combusting appliance whilst burning wood.

Hetas Approved

All harmony wood burning stoves are approved byHetas which is the official body recognised by the government to approve solid fuel domestic heating appliances, fuels and services.

The Harmony Family

The range starts with the small Harmony 13 (H13) which suits small, cosy rooms. Slighty larger the Harmony 23 (H23), for modern living areas. The Harmony 33 (H33) is suitable for larger spaces or open plan areas. Whilst the Harmony 43 (H43), is bigger and wider than the rest, for heating large room volumes.
